WebRust source code that contains the plugin definition and sqlx features. /webview-src Typescript source for the /webview-dist folder that provides an API to interface with the rust code. /webview-dist Tree-shakeable transpiled JS to be consumed in a Tauri application. /bindings Forthcoming tauri bindings to other programming languages, like DENO. Web封装 tauri 状态. 我们需要使用 rust 标准库中的 Mutex 互斥锁以及 tauri 的 state 来让我们封装的 TodoApp 对象能够跨进程调用,首先新建一个AppState结构体做状态管理。 然后 …
扔掉 Electron,拥抱基于 Rust 开发的 Tauri - InfoQ 写作平台
WebAug 28, 2024 · 接上节继续,今天来研究tauri的事件(event),假设老板提了个需求,希望能实时监控cpu、内存等性能指标,你会怎么做?. 思路1 :. 后端Rust暴露1个command, … WebJan 16, 2024 · Tauri itself is written in Rust and your back-end application will be a Rust application that provides "commands" through tauri in much the same way that a Rust web-server provides routes. You can even have managed state, for things like sqlite databases! Open src/main.rs in the src-tauri project and add the following below the main() function: poke definition noun
GitHub - tauri-apps/tauri: Build smaller, faster, and more secure ...
我们将使用一个 HTML 文件打造一个极为简单的界面。 为了让项目结构整洁,我们来为它创建一个单独的文件夹: 随后,在刚刚创建的文件夹中新建一个 … See more 每款 Tauri 应用的核心都是由一个管理窗口的 Rust 二进制文件、WebView 和进行系统调用的 tauri Rust 包构成。 此项目使用官方的软件包管理器及 Rust 通用构建工 … See more Tauri 为您的前端开发提供了其他系统原生功能。 我们将其称作指令,这使得您可以从 JavaScript 前端调用由 Rust 编写的函数。 由此,您可以使用性能飞快 … See more WebAug 20, 2024 · 接 上节 继续,今天研究tauri中,前端如何调用Rust代码。. 一、无返回值&无传参. main.rs中加1个hello方法:. 然后在main方法中,参考下图暴露hello1: Rust代 … WebApr 6, 2024 · 另外,Rust 与本地 C 语言调用约定和库集成的方式相似,Rust 还应... 腾讯IV团队. 这些前端新技术你很难再忽视了 —— Tauri. 今年 6 月才刚发布,简直就跟 … poke cypress tx